Data          benchmarking             efficiency

• Data is the lifeblood of energy management
• Benchmarking is an energy management practice
  that is data-dependent
• EPA’s Portfolio Manager tool is widely used to
  benchmark buildings.
• EPA analysis shows a 2.4%/year improvement (7%
  over three years) for 35,000 buildings in Portfolio
  Manager.
• Recent CPUC evaluation links benchmarking to
  energy saving actions
Data Access Involves Policy and
              Technology
• Relevant Public Utility Commission Policies
   – Data privacy
   – Rules for data aggregation
   – Recovery of costs
• Utilities
   – Implementation costs
   – Funding
   – Integration with technical platforms

Methods for Benchmarking with EPA’s
        Portfolio Manager
•   Single Building Manual Entry
•   Bulk Data Upload
    –   Upload large sets of building data using an Excel template
•   Portfolio Manager Data Exchange
    –   Internet-based (i.e., web services) system for exchanging data
        between EPA’s Portfolio Manager and a third party system.
        (formerly automated benchmarking system (ABS))
    –   Over 70 energy service providers are supplying data to benchmark
        60,000 buildings each month
    –   Ten utilities have provided energy data to benchmark over 16,000
        buildings
Upgrade to Portfolio Manager
EPA upgrade goals
• Easier to use
   – Completely new user interface
   – Make data entry more user friendly, like TurboTax®
   – Enhanced sharing features
• Streamlined system database
   – Faster processing
   – Easier to update in the future
• Modern approach to exchanging data via web service
   – New REST-based web services
   – Granular and synchronous services improve opportunities for
     new applications
Green Button can increase access to
energy data in a standard, electronic way

 • An industry-led, White House inspired effort to encourage
   private energy suppliers to make personal energy usage data
   available to their customers
 • 35 utilities and electricity suppliers in various regulatory
   regimes across the country have committed to provide 36
   million US homes and businesses with Green Button data
    – over 16 million of which already have access today!
 • Green Button Download My Data and Connect My Data
 • Future direction:
    – Continued adoption and implementation of Green Button
    – Natural gas data is starting to be released in the GB format
    – Can also use the data standard for DERs: solar, EVs to building or to
      grid
Green Button: common way to express energy data
                      for use in lots of different applications
  One example of GB data: the amount of electricity (kWh) one metered customer
  consumed every hour for the last 12 months
A commercial building owner could use Green Button data for the following applications:

                  • Insight: entrepreneur-created web portals analyze energy usage and
                    provide actionable tips;

                  • Heating and Cooling: customized heating and cooling activities for
                    savings and comfort;

                  • Retrofits: improved decision-support tools to facilitate energy
                    efficiency retrofits such as virtual energy audits;

                  • Verification: measurement of energy efficiency investments;

                  • Solar: optimize the size and cost-effectiveness of rooftop solar panels.

                  • And Benchmarking…

           • Green Button can play a role in helping building owners get access to their
             energy consumption data from utilities for use in Portfolio Manager.

           • Green Button data could either be transferred to Portfolio Manager
             through direct manual or automated transfers to Portfolio Manager or
             through a third party service provider.
